Description
A delightful dish that perfectly balances flavors and textures with grilled chicken, crisp-tender broccoli, and a creamy garlic sauce.
Ingredients
- 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 2 cups broccoli florets
- 1 cup cooked grains (rice, quinoa, couscous, etc.)
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/2 cup heavy cream
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t and black pepper, to taste
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- Optional: Fresh parsley or chives for garnish
Instructions
- Grill the Chicken: Start by seasoning the chicken breasts with olive oil, salt, pepper, and any optional spices.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at and cook the chicken for about 6-7 minutes on each side until it reaches an internal temperature of 165°F.
- Roast the Broccoli: While the chicken is grilling, toss the broccoli florets in olive oil, lemon juice, and a pinch of salt. Spread them on a baking sheet and roast at 400°F for 15-20 minutes until they’re crisp-tender.
- Cook the Grains: Prepare your chosen grains according to the package instructions. Fluff with a fork and keep warm.
- Make the Creamy Garlic Sauce: In a sa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Add minced garlic and sauté until fragrant, about a minute. Stir in the heavy cream, season with salt and pepper, and let it simmer until slightly thickened.
- Assemble the Bowls: In serving bowls, layer your cooked grains, sliced grilled chicken, and roasted broccoli. Drizzle with the creamy garlic sauce and garnish with fresh herbs, if desired.
Notes
Consider marinating the chicken for a few hours before grilling for enhanced flavor. Allow the sauce to simmer for a rich garlic taste.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
